What is HRV?
HRV, or heart rate variability, is the variation in time between one heartbeat and the next. Even at a steady 60 beats per minute, your heart doesn’t tick like a metronome. One interval might be 0.95 seconds, the next 1.05, the next 0.98. Those millisecond-level differences are normal, and they partly reflect your autonomic nervous system at work.
That system has two sides that pull in opposite directions:
- The sympathetic branch: revs you up in response to stress, effort, or a demanding situation.
- The parasympathetic branch: brings you back down, supporting rest and recovery.
Higher HRV is often linked to better recovery, but it’s not an absolute rule. Age, fitness, sleep, stress, illness, travel, and training load all move the number around. The most reliable approach is to follow your own trend rather than compare your figure with someone else’s.
Heart rate vs HRV: what’s the difference?
Heart rate tells you how many times your heart beats per minute. HRV tells you how much the spacing between those beats varies.
| Indicator | What it measures | Example |
|---|---|---|
| Heart rate | Number of beats per minute | 60 bpm |
| HRV | Variation in time between two beats | 35 ms, 50 ms, 80 ms |
Two people can share the same resting heart rate and have very different HRV, and that doesn’t mean one recovers better than the other. The question that matters is whether your current value fits your own usual range.
Why nighttime HRV matters most
Nighttime HRV is so useful because it’s captured during rest. Through the day, caffeine, meals, training, stress, travel, and even a change of posture all nudge your HRV around. At night, conditions settle, so a sleep measurement gives you a much cleaner read on your recovery trend.

RMSSD: the metric behind the number
HRV can be quantified in several ways, but for recovery tracking most sports watches lean on nighttime readings and an indicator called RMSSD (root mean square of successive differences).
Without wading into the math, RMSSD looks at the successive changes between heartbeats and picks up shifts in your autonomic nervous system, especially during rest and sleep. For athletes, it’s a good reflection of how the body bounces back after training, stress, or a heavy physical load, which makes it well suited to overnight HRV tracking.

What counts as a “normal” HRV in ms?
There isn’t one. HRV depends on age, fitness, sleep, stress, genetics, lifestyle, and personal history, so an isolated number means very little out of context. An HRV of 30 ms could be entirely normal for one person and low for another.
A few principles worth remembering:
- Good HRV is, first and foremost, HRV that matches your personal normal range.
- 30 ms isn’t “bad” if it lines up with your history.
- Low HRV can reflect fatigue, stress, short sleep, or a heavy training load.
- High HRV is often positive, but an unusual jump deserves a second look.
- A trend across several days beats any single measurement.
In short, read HRV as a personal trend, not a universal score.
How to interpret low, normal, and high HRV
HRV is individual, but a few common scenarios help you spot the broad patterns.
| HRV result | Likely meaning | Possible causes | How to adapt |
|---|---|---|---|
| Lower than usual | Fatigue, stress, or incomplete recovery | Hard session, poor sleep, stress, alcohol, travel, early illness | Reduce intensity or plan an easier day |
| Within your normal range | Your body’s usual response | Stable recovery, controlled load | Keep the planned session if you feel good |
| Slightly higher than usual | Potentially strong recovery | Rest, good sleep, well-absorbed load | Consider a harder session if everything feels right |
| Very high or unusual | An atypical response | Accumulated fatigue, routine change, stress, or heavy unloading | Check other signals before adding load |
Treat this as a guide, not a verdict. Your real state also depends on how you feel, your sleep, your resting heart rate, and your recent training.
Low HRV usually means your body is carrying a real load. It often shows up after an intense session, a race, a rough night’s sleep, or a stressful stretch. Common culprits include:
- A long or intense training session
- Accumulated fatigue
- Too little or poor-quality sleep
- Significant mental stress
- Alcohol
- Dehydration
- Travel or a change in routine
- The early stages of illness
- A training load that’s stayed too high for several days
A temporary dip after a long run, an interval session, or a hard race is completely normal; it simply reflects the effort you put in. But if your HRV stays below your normal range for several days, it’s worth acting on:
- Dial back the intensity.
- Swap a hard interval session for an easy run, ride, or recovery day.
- Add a rest day.
- Prioritise sleep duration and regularity.
- Hydrate better.
- Skip alcohol during heavy training blocks.
Prolonged low HRV often travels with other signs too: heavier fatigue, flagging motivation, slower recovery, and less consistent performance.
High HRV: always a good sign?
Often, yes. If your HRV is a touch above normal and you feel rested, motivated, and energetic, that’s a positive signal. But an unusually high reading, one that leaps well above your trend, doesn’t automatically mean you should pile on load. It can reflect a strong recovery swing known as a parasympathetic rebound, especially after a period of fatigue, stress, or heavy training.
To read it accurately, check the context:
- Did you sleep well?
- Is your resting heart rate where it usually is?
- Do you genuinely feel rested?
- Have you recently ramped up your training?
- Have you travelled or changed your routine?
- Has the rise lasted several days, or just one night?
The aim isn’t to chase the highest possible HRV. It’s to keep a stable trend that matches your overall state.
HRV, sleep, and training load: read them together
HRV means the most in context. A short dip might just mark a tough session. A repeated dip alongside poor sleep and unusual fatigue is a clearer call for recovery. To avoid misreading the signal, keep an eye on the whole picture:
- Your nighttime HRV
- Sleep duration and quality
- Resting heart rate
- Recent training load
- How you feel: energy, motivation, muscle fatigue
You don’t need to dissect each one every day. Together, they explain why your HRV rises or falls.

How to improve your HRV
You can’t force HRV up directly, but you can improve the conditions that support recovery.
Sleep more consistently
Sleep regularity is one of the biggest levers. Keep your bedtimes and wake times reasonably steady, especially during heavy training.
Adapt your training load
Too much load for too many days pushes HRV down. Alternate hard sessions, easy sessions, and recovery days.
Avoid intense sessions late at night
Hard evening training can disrupt sleep and delay your nervous system’s return to calm.
Limit alcohol and stay hydrated
Alcohol disrupts sleep and nighttime HRV. Good hydration, particularly after training or in the heat, supports recovery too.
Manage stress
Mental stress shows up in HRV. Simple habits like breathing, walking, reading, or meditation help your body settle.
Why HRV matters for endurance training
For runners, trail runners, cyclists, and triathletes, progress lives in the balance between load and recovery. You need enough training stress to trigger adaptation, and enough rest to avoid digging a hole. HRV adds context to that balancing act.
In marathon training, a sustained drop can be the hint that a lighter week will pay off. In trail running, it helps you see how your body is coping with long days, big vertical, and back-to-back sessions. For cyclists, it adds nuance to muscle feel and load data. For triathletes, it helps you monitor fatigue building across three disciplines.
And it isn’t just for pros. Any regular endurance athlete can use HRV to understand their recovery better and avoid overdoing it.

Common mistakes when reading HRV
Comparing your HRV with other people’s
HRV is deeply individual. Your normal can differ from a friend’s even if you’re the same age and similar fitness.
Overreacting to a single night
One dip or spike is normal. Trends across several days carry far more weight.
Assuming higher is always better
High HRV can be positive, but an unusual jump deserves careful reading.
Ignoring how you feel
HRV is a useful signal, not a replacement for your own sense of sleep, energy, and training experience.
